    Description

    Ryanair are currently recruiting for a Training Standards Manager to join Europe's Largest Airline Group

    This is a very exciting time to join Ryanair as we look to expand our operation to 800 aircraft and 300 million guests within the next 10 years.

    The Training Standards Manager will work within the Engineering Training department. Within this job role, you'll gain core experience working in a compliance and legislative role in accordance with EASA and national authority regulations. You will be part of a strong team delivering industry leading training. This is an excellent opportunity for a highly motivated and proactive individual with prior experience in a compliance and/or engineering quality assurance role to further enhance your career.

    The person will report directly to the Head of Training and will be responsible for ensuring that Ryanair Training programs meets Regulatory and Ryanair's industry leading standards.

    Duties will include:

    • Responsible for ensuring the training organisation meets the requirement of regulation and compliance with all National Aviation Authorities (NAAs) and EASA Part 66, 145 and 147 requirements.
    • Provide oversight for all applications for non-CRS, internal approval and NAA licence applications on time and within forecasting plans.
    • Provide oversight of CAT A/B licence logbooks for all NAA's under EASA
    • Ensure all aspects of the Part-145 authorization, company MOE and company procedures are always complied with.
    • Constant review of EASA Part 145 & 147 regulations to ensure the training school is fully compliant with regulation.
    • Work alongside the quality assurance department to ensure standards and procedures are conversant and in line with the company's expectations.
    • Create an annual internal audit program for the training department and carry out audits to ensure the department remains fully compliant.

    Requirements

    • 5 years' experience working within the aircraft industry.
    • Hold an Aerospace Engineering degree, aircraft engineering licence or has experience in a compliance-based role.
    • Ideally hold knowledge of EASA Part 145, 147 & Part 66 regulations.
    • Ability to ensure on-time performance and processing of applications in accordance with operational plans.
    • Ability to plan and work to deadlines and on own initiative.
    • Excellent working knowledge of all Microsoft packages
    • Ability to identify opportunities for improvement and efficiently implement changes.
    • Applicants must be open minded, excited about learning new skills and have a strong work ethic.
    • Must hold a valid EU passport.
